Megan Fox has revealed she was deeply affected by early fame. The actress described feeling “traumatized” by her sudden rise to stardom. She became a global star after her role in the 2007 blockbuster ‘Transformers’.

Fox explained this difficult period filled her with intense negative emotions. She found a creative outlet for these feelings in her subsequent work.
Catharsis Through a Demon Role
Fox credited her role in the 2009 film ‘Jennifer’s Body’ as a form of therapy. She played a demon-possessed teenage girl who kills her classmates. This character gave her permission to be “unhinged,” which she found cathartic.
She stated the role resonated with her personal sense of persecution. Fox felt she was “sacrificed for somebody else’s gain” in her early career. According to Reuters, such personal revelations from actors about mental health are becoming more common in Hollywood.
The Lasting Impact of Early Stardom
Fox’s experience highlights the pressures on young actors in the industry. She was only 19 when she landed her first major movie role. The constant media scrutiny and paparazzi attention were overwhelming for her.
Her story adds to a growing conversation about child and young adult stardom. Many former teen stars have spoken about similar struggles with mental health. This public discussion helps shed light on the darker sides of the entertainment business.
